Output fa715f7d3a979ccc839ba7213ce698527e320145e7800ed638d17c126b719a2d:0

value
20683000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 333175a577cef22e890d66983b1b0015625b8330 OP_EQUAL
address
36MhdqWxbU6aveQrzccTNCAj3DmT28vKMY
transaction
fa715f7d3a979ccc839ba7213ce698527e320145e7800ed638d17c126b719a2d
confirmations
356553
spent
true